Ethel Maye Myers
Ethel Maye Myers, 89, of Sligo died at 10:51 a.m. Tuesday at the Clarion Hospital.
Born June 25, 1918, in Porter Township, Clarion County, she was the daughter of Frank and Lulu McDonald Polliard.
A 1936 graduate of Clarion High School, she was a homemaker and enjoyed sewing, crocheting, camping and traveling.
Mrs. Myers was a devout member of the Monroe Chapel United Methodist Church near Reidsburg.
Surviving are three daughters and their husbands, Shirley and Rawland Fox of Butler, Gladine and Terry Botzer of Limestone and Marcia and Dan Gathers of Rimersburg; twin sons and their wives, Donald and Karen Myers of Rimersburg and Ronald and Joan Myers of Butler; 14 grandchildren; 37 great-grandchildren; and two great-great-grandchildren.
Her husband, Jay Myers, whom she married Oct. 8, 1936, died Sept. 13, 1996. She also was preceded in death by a grandson, Dale Myers.
